Registered Agent Requirements and Costs

To establish a legally compliant enterprise, every corporation must designate a designated agent. The primary requirement is that the registered agent must be a citizen of the jurisdiction where the business is established or a registered agent company authorized to work in that state. The agent must have a location, known as the designated office, where legal documents can be received during regular business hours. Additionally, some jurisdictions have certain regulations regarding the qualifications of the registered agent, such as requiring them to be at least eighteen years old or to have a certain level of professionalism.

Regarding expenses, hiring a registered agent typically includes various costs that can vary widely based on the assistance provided. Most registered agent services charge an yearly fee that can start at affordable options starting around 50 dollars to more costly packages that may include additional services like compliance notifications and document processing. It is important to consider not only the first-time costs but also the possible for continuation costs each year and any additional offerings that might be required to ensure ongoing conformance.

Differences Between Regional and National Registered Agents

When selecting a registered agent, businesses often confront the decision of choosing local and nationwide registered agents. Regional registered agents are typically based in the same state as your company, providing legal support customized to state-specific regulations and requirements. This can be advantageous for companies that conduct business within one state and prefer having immediate, face-to-face communication with their agent. Local knowledge can enhance compliance with state regulations and ease the process of handling documents related to service of process.

Conversely, nationwide registered agents offer businesses the ability to streamline operations across multiple states. For companies looking to expand or operate in multiple jurisdictions, nationwide registered agent services may provide seamless compliance management. This type of agent is able to handle filings, notifications, and legal documents for various states from a centralized location, making it simpler for businesses to manage their statutory obligations and maintain compliance no matter where they operate.

In conclusion, the decision between a regional or nationwide registered agent depends on the individual needs of your company. If you are focused on a particular state and appreciate a personal touch, a local agent could be perfect. Conversely, if you are planning for growth or require services in several states, a nationwide agent can provide complete and effective registered agent solutions, making certain you meet all compliance requirements without the hassle of managing multiple providers.
